Low Energy X-Ray and Electron Physics for Materials Analysis.

Abstract

The program of this grant period has been directed to research, independent and collaborative in the application of low energy x-ray and electron physics to the following areas: (1) surface state, molecular and solid state analysis by ultrasoft x-ray spectroscopy; (2) development of methods for quantitative photoelectron spectroscopic analysis for surface structure and chemistry; and (3) the development of techniques for high temperature plasma diagnostics by low energy x-ray spectroscopy. Activities, some results, and techniques and equipment are briefly described. (Modified author abstract)
